After a 20 year battle I had to admit that, although I managed controlled drinking sometimes, the effort was immense, and there were still many more times when I lost control.
those lost control moments got more and more and the years and my alcoholism progressed.
Accepting that I wasn't, and would never be a normal drinker was actually a great weight off my shoulders.
Normal drinkers don't have to fight so bone crunchingly hard to be normal - they just are.
